THE ULTIMATE WEB PROVIDER HANDBOOK: EVERYTHING YOU REQUIRED TO KNOW

The Ultimate Web Provider Handbook: Everything You Required To Know

The Ultimate Web Provider Handbook: Everything You Required To Know

Blog Article

Web Content Writer-Kaae Cramer

Discover the ultimate Web Solutions Handbook for all your demands. Check out interaction methods, core ideas of SOAP and REST, and best techniques for smooth application. Discover the tricks to grasping web solutions, from recognizing the essentials to implementing scalable style. Master the art of developing secure systems and enhancing for future development. Open the power of internet services at your fingertips.

Introduction of Internet Providers



If you've ever questioned what internet services are and just how they work, this review is the excellent location to begin. Web solutions are a means for different applications to connect with each other over the internet. They enable seamless combination of systems, making it simpler to share data and performances.

One of the vital aspects of internet solutions is their use of basic protocols like HTTP and XML to promote interaction. This standardization ensures that different systems can understand and connect with each other efficiently. Internet services can be classified right into 2 main types: SOAP (Simple Object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der depends on conventional HTTP techniques like GET, PUBLISH, PUT, and remove. Both have their strengths and are used in different situations based on requirements.

Trick Principles and Technologies



Checking out the foundational principles and technologies of internet services is important for recognizing their functionality and application in modern-day systems. When delving into the vital ideas and modern technologies of internet services, you unlock to a globe of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Item Access Method) **: This protocol defines the structure of messages exchanged between internet services.
- ** WSDL (Web Services Summary Language) **: WSDL is made use of to describe the performances provided by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that utilizes standard HTTP techniques for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in information exchange between internet solutions because of its versatility and readability.

Recognizing these core principles and innovations will certainly lay a strong structure for your trip into the world of web solutions.

Best Practices for Execution



To ensure effective application of web services, focus on adherence to finest techniques. Begin by extensively documenting your web solution APIs, including clear descriptions of endpoints, parameters, and anticipated responses. Regular naming conventions and versioning of APIs are important for maintainability. When making your web solutions, comply with the principles of REST to develop a scalable and adaptable architecture. Apply proper authentication and permission systems to safeguard your services, such as OAuth or API tricks.

Checking is crucial in making certain the reliability of your web solutions. Create ada compliance for website accessibility that cover different situations, consisting of favorable and adverse screening. Constant integration and automated testing can aid capture concerns early in the advancement procedure. Screen https://jeffreyjcvng.liberty-blog.com/29972648/boost-your-pay-per-click-projects-by-making-use-of-efficient-keyword-study-strategies-that-will-certainly-change-your-marketing-efficiency-learn-more-today in real-time to determine efficiency traffic jams and potential failures. Logging and error handling are crucial for detecting concerns and fixing problems effectively.


Finally, think about the scalability of your web services deliberately for future development. Execute caching systems and tons harmonizing to take care of boosted website traffic. Routinely review and optimize your code for performance. By adhering to these best practices, you can enhance the implementation of internet solutions and ensure their success.

Verdict

Congratulations! You've simply unlocked the key to mastering internet services. By comprehending the essential principles and innovations, and carrying out best methods, you're well on your method to coming to be a web services expert.

Maintain exploring and trying out what you've learned to proceed expanding your knowledge and abilities in this exciting area.

The world of web solutions is currently within your reaches, ready for you to check out and conquer. Appreciate the journey!